13569-97-6 Usage
Uses
Used in Pharmaceutical Industry:
4-(1H-Imidazol-4-yl)benzoic acid is used as a building block for the synthesis of various pharmaceuticals and organic compounds. Its unique chemical structure allows it to be a key component in the development of new drugs with potential therapeutic applications.
Used in Organic Chemistry Research:
In the field of organic chemistry, 4-(1H-Imidazol-4-yl)benzoic acid serves as a reagent for the synthesis of other complex molecules. Its versatility in chemical reactions makes it a valuable tool for researchers working on the development of novel organic compounds.
Used in Medicinal Research:
4-(1H-Imidazol-4-yl)benzoic acid is being researched for its potential medicinal properties. Its exploration in the treatment of various diseases highlights its potential as a therapeutic agent, contributing to the advancement of medical science.
Check Digit Verification of cas no
The CAS Registry Mumber 13569-97-6 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 1,3,5,6 and 9 respectively; the second part has 2 digits, 9 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 13569-97:
(7*1)+(6*3)+(5*5)+(4*6)+(3*9)+(2*9)+(1*7)=126
126 % 10 = 6
So 13569-97-6 is a valid CAS Registry Number.
